    Best Wood Species for Your Area

    Oak and hickory are your most reliable choices in Woodstock. White oak burns hot and long, producing around 24 million BTU per cord—ideal for all-night burns and steady heat output. Hickory matches that performance at roughly 24 million BTU per cord and ignites easily, making it perfect for fireplaces or wood stoves. Both species are widely available throughout Illinois and season well in our climate.

    Avoid elm, cottonwood, and soft maple; they produce excessive creosote buildup in your chimney and deliver poor heat compared to hardwoods. If a supplier offers "mixed hardwood," ask specifically what's included.

    Seasoning and Moisture Content

    This is non-negotiable: your firewood must be seasoned to 20% moisture or lower. Green or wet wood creates excessive smoke, won't ignite reliably, and deposits dangerous creosote in your chimney. When firewood is delivered to your home, inspect the logs for these signs of proper seasoning:

    • End cracks: Well-seasoned logs show radial cracks (spoke-like) on the cut ends
    • Bark looseness: Dry bark pulls away from the wood; wet bark clings tight
    • Sound test: Strike two logs together; seasoned wood produces a hollow ring, not a dull thud

    Don't accept firewood that's been "seasoned for 3 months"—hardwoods need 6–12 months to reach 20% moisture, depending on storage conditions and initial cut size.

    Delivery, Stacking, and Quantities

    Local firewood delivered and stacked in Woodstock typically arrives within 1–2 weeks of ordering, though demand spikes September through November. Most suppliers offer:

    • Full cord: 128 cubic feet (standard unit for measuring firewood)
    • Half cord: 64 cubic feet (fits most residential storage areas)
    • Quarter cord: 32 cubic feet (good for testing a new supplier)

    If stacking is included, verify the wood gets stacked neatly with airflow between rows. Ask whether delivery includes placement near your home or pile location—some suppliers drop wood at the curb and leave the rest to you.

    Watch for the Emerald Ash Borer

    Illinois has an active Emerald Ash Borer population, which infests and kills ash trees. Never buy ash firewood unless it's from a certified pest-free source with paperwork to back it up. When ordering from local suppliers, confirm they source wood from oak, hickory, maple, or fruitwood stands, not ash.

    Always buy firewood sourced within 50 miles of Woodstock to minimize the risk of transporting invasive pests.
